If your house was built after 1986 (when lead water … Web27 sep. 2016 · The water utility industry as a whole has acknowledged the uncertainties in tracking down lead pipes. A March 2016 report from the American Water Works Association indicates that lead service lines still in use could number anywhere between 5.5 and 7.1 million — a pretty big margin of difference.

Web21 nov. 2024 · When the EPA's lead and copper rule was first implemented in 1991, the agency estimated that about 10 million lead lines were in service nationwide. An estimated 6.1 million remain in U.S.... WebWater pipes are no longer made from lead, but older cities, such as Flint, still rely on lead pipes—in addition to those made from copper and iron—to transport water to people’s homes. No one knows exactly how many lead pipes are used in the United States, but the number is in the millions.
